How long do custom window coverings take to install?

Most residential installations are completed in one day, while larger commercial projects may take several days depending on the scope. The timeline starts with a consultation and measurement appointment, followed by a 2-3 week manufacturing period for custom treatments. Motorized systems may require additional time for electrical coordination, but the actual installation process is typically faster than manual systems since there’s no need for cord routing and hardware adjustments.
Florida requires materials that resist UV damage, humidity, and temperature fluctuations. Cellular shades provide excellent insulation, while exterior treatments like outdoor roller shades block heat before it reaches windows. Motorized options eliminate cord degradation from sun exposure. For commercial spaces, vinyl and aluminum treatments offer durability and easy cleaning. The key is choosing treatments specifically rated for high-UV environments and ensuring proper ventilation to prevent moisture buildup.

Commercial window coverings are built for higher durability, frequent use, and easier maintenance. They often use heavier-duty materials, reinforced mounting systems, and components designed for thousands of operation cycles. Commercial installations also consider factors like fire safety codes, accessibility requirements, and coordinated appearance across multiple rooms or floors. Residential treatments focus more on aesthetic customization, energy efficiency, and integration with home decor, though the quality standards remain equally high.
Motorized window treatment costs vary based on window size, fabric selection, and automation features. Basic motorized roller shades typically start around $300-500 per window, while complex systems with smart home integration and premium materials can range higher. The investment pays off through energy savings, convenience, and increased property value. Commercial installations often qualify for bulk pricing, and the durability of motorized systems means lower long-term maintenance costs compared to manual alternatives that experience wear from daily use.
